🧮 General Information

  • Arduino : For uploading code to make the automatically executing from the Arduino UNO R3
  • Mobile : Using Flutter to build the UI of mobile application
  • Client : Using Vitejs is a tool to build ReactJS UI
  • Server : Using FLask framework to build the server

📋 Features

List the ready features here:

----- Features
Arduino Checking distance, automatically open the barrier when having the signal, LED on to guide customer to the parking slot
Mobile Login, Register, Homepage, Profile, Logout
Client View user active, Take license plate picture
Server Authentication, OCR scanning, Facial recognition
